Westmont vs. Emerson

The following statements compare Westmont College and Emerson College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• Emerson's tuition ($55,392) is more expensive than Westmont ($51,790).
  • Emerson's acceptance rate (42.75%) is lower than Westmont (81.99%).
  • Emerson has higher yield (19.36%) than Westmont (16.52%).
  • Westmont's SAT score (1,375) is higher than Emerson (1,360).
  • Westmont's students to faculty ratio (10 to 1) is lower than Emerson (15 to 1).
  • Emerson (5,891 students) is larger than Westmont (1,284 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Westmont ($33,189) has higher amount of financial aid than Emerson ($24,566).
  • Emerson's graduation rate (77%) is higher than Westmont (73%).
